package provider import ( "testing" ) func TestParseLocalDiskID(t *testing.T) { tests := map[string]struct { input string want string }{ "empty string": { input: "", want: "", }, "generic string": { input: "test", want: "test", }, "AWS node provider id": { input: "aws:///us-east-2a/i-0fea4fd46592d050b", want: "i-0fea4fd46592d050b", }, "GCP node provider id": { input: "gce://guestbook-11111/us-central1-a/gke-niko-n1-standard-2-wlkla-8d48e58a-hfy7", want: "gke-niko-n1-standard-2-wlkla-8d48e58a-hfy7", }, "Azure vmss provider id": { input: "azure:///subscriptions/ae337b64-e7ba-3387-b043-187289efe4e3/resourceGroups/mc_test_eastus2/providers/Microsoft.Compute/virtualMachineScaleSets/aks-userpool-12345678-vmss/virtualMachines/11", want: "azure:///subscriptions/ae337b64-e7ba-3387-b043-187289efe4e3/resourcegroups/mc_test_eastus2/providers/microsoft.compute/disks/aks-userpool-12345678-vmss00000b_osdisk", }, "Azure vm provider id": { input: "azure:///subscriptions/ae337b64-e7ba-3387-b043-187289efe4e3/resourceGroups/mc_test_eastus2/providers/Microsoft.Compute/virtualMachines/master-0", want: "azure:///subscriptions/ae337b64-e7ba-3387-b043-187289efe4e3/resourcegroups/mc_test_eastus2/providers/microsoft.compute/disks/master-0_osdisk", }, } for name, tt := range tests { t.Run(name, func(t *testing.T) { if got := ParseLocalDiskID(tt.input); got != tt.want { t.Errorf("ParseLocalDiskID() = %v, want %v", got, tt.want) } }) } }
